Hood RV Decatur AL
Wanted to let folks in the Tri State area know that Hood RV is your go to dealership for repairs & towable sales!
Anne-Marie and I went to the dealership at the suggestion of Rob Walworth (FR Corporate Sales) as the closest dealership for ROckwood & Cardinal 5th Wheels.
WOW was that a good visit.. Rodney & Nick Johnston (Owner and General Manager) made us feel right at home and it seems that Hood RV had hired some of the fine folks that used to work at Dandy RV as well!
So if you are in the market for a FR Towable or are on I65 near exit 334 and need FR parts, service or RV accessories (they have a small but well stocked RV store with great prices.) I can personally vouch for Hood RV

Bought my TT from them last July. Their techs seemed to break three things for every one they fixed. They installed an electrical outlet upside down. They fouled up television wiring. Messed up our wall trim next to the fridge. Fouled up my speaker wiring. Incorrectly installed a winterization valve. Last straw was a water pump they replaced that they did not even mount-just left it hanging by the water hoses. I gladly paid 3x what they charged for my annual "RV Warranty Forever" inspection because I did not trust them to correctly inspect/repair anything. Glad your experience was good, Bob, but their service dept lost my confidence. I hate being a Gloomy-Gus and contradictory, but just wanted readers to understand that their experience, like mine, may differ drastically.

Again All, this is a "That was then, This is now" situation. Rodney & Nick Johnston just acquired Hood RV (I believe) early this year.
They have made some pretty sweeping changes, hired the finance officer that used to work at Dandy RV (Camping world Acquired them last NOV) and completely revamped the service department. They now specialize in tow-behinds. The do not sell Class A, B or C MH, but I suspect if someone was in trouble they could service the RV part of the MH but not the drivetrain.
The dealership really is "Under New Management."
